A particle falling vertically from a height hits a plane surface inclined to horizontal at an angle \( \theta \) with speed \( v_{o} \) and rebounds elastically . Find the distance along the plane where if will hit second time.
(Hint: (i) After rebound, particle still has speed \( V_{o} \) to start.
(ii) Work out angle particle speed has with horizontal after it rebounds.
(iii) Rest is similar to if particle is projected up the incline.)
